Chapter 135: Demonic Cultivators’ Infighting
Just then, another voice tried to mediate: “All right, all right. We’re all here for the same thing. No need to ruin the mood over this little girl. Let’s keep it fair and compete.”
A Jade Cauldron Sect demonic cultivator smiled behind her hand as she said: “From what I’ve observed these days, this little girl will go practice sword in a small grove soon.”
She added, “The place isn’t big, but it’s quiet and empty. We can make our move there.”
Voices rose in agreement: “Fine.”
Someone added, “But let’s say this up front. Whoever grabs the little girl first, the rest do not snatch.”
More answers followed: “Fine.” “No problem.”
On the surface the dozen or so demonic cultivators were all amicable, though what lay in their hearts was anyone’s guess.
They fanned out and hid around Rong Shu, their gazes burning holes in her back.
At this moment Rong Shu walked along kneading the Little Hamster in her hands as if she had no sense at all of the danger coiling closer. She even hummed a snatch of tune under her breath.
The instant Rong Shu stepped into the grove, every lurking demonic cultivator grew restless with excitement.
They lunged toward the grove, each fearing that a moment’s delay would let someone else beat them to it.
Then, from somewhere, several Shadow Darts suddenly flew, streaking toward four or five demonic cultivators.
Already wary of one another, the demonic cultivators reacted instantly and dodged.
Though no one was hurt, that volley was a fuse that tore open what had been an uneasy peace.
Without another word, the demonic cultivators began launching frenzied attacks at one another.
“It had to be you, you turtle-born bastard!”
“Bullshit, you sneak-attacked me!”
“You bald donkey, I’ve endured you long enough!”
While chaos exploded, the culprit, Liu Kai, was feeling rather pleased with himself as he reported to the one guiding him from behind the scenes: “You called it. I tossed a few darts and they started fighting.”
He urged, “How about you? Have you made your move? Grab Rong Shu and let’s run!”
Many in this pack were at the ninth or tenth layer of Qi Refining.
Liu Kai was only at the seventh. He was outmatched.
He figured Xu Liu thought the same. Better to have Xu Liu snatch the girl and bolt.
On the other side, the quarry in everyone’s eyes, Rong Shu, read the message from her “good brother” Liu Kai and allowed a small smile.
“Well done,” she sent back. “Keep stalling them. I’ve already slipped into the grove.”
Receiving “Xu Liu’s” reply, Liu Kai’s eyes lit.
Good fellow.
That brat Xu Liu was devious.
He had gone in and ambushed early.
Liu Kai rejoiced. He would wait outside for Xu Liu’s good news, and help block anyone else from entering the grove.
After sending the message, Rong Shu was about to trigger the array when a surge of danger welled up—behind her.
The next instant she sprang from where she had stood.
Almost at the same moment, a black mass swelled up from the spot she had just vacated.
The shadow seemed surprised by Rong Shu’s reaction speed. It pushed up from the ground, bulging and coalescing into a blurry human shape.
The man laughed, gloating as he said: “Little girl, didn’t expect it, did you? I’ve been waiting for you inside the grove.”
He crowed, “Hahaha, you’re mine now.”
Rong Shu eyed the man who had taken shape with a faintly odd look as she asked: “You came in early?”
He boasted, “That’s right. Those idiots only know how to stalk you, but I’m different. I set my ambush in advance. I even cleaned out a few fools who were hiding here before.”
Halfway through his brag, he realized something was off.
He snapped his head toward Rong Shu.
Wait.
Why was this little girl so calm?
According to plan, shouldn’t she be terrified and helpless at the sight of him?
And what did she mean by “You came in early”?
What do you mean, he came in early?
As the man’s mind brushed the answer, a cold light flashed before his eyes.
A keen horizontal blade came straight for his face.
Startled, the man dissolved into shadow and sank into the ground.
At the same time, Rong Shu flicked out the last Formation Disc, tossed it to the earth, and triggered the entire setup.
In an instant, the grove flared with bands of white light.
The hidden Formation Discs activated together, weaving an array that sealed everyone within the grove.
“What is this?”
“A formation? Where did a formation come from?!”
The surge of power drew the attention of the other demonic cultivators in the grove.
They lost their composure at once.
To them this had been nothing more than a routine hunt.
Their only headache had been guarding against the other hunters. Now…
Rong Shu did not hesitate. As the array locked in place, she slashed again at the shadow man.
His expression shifted several times before he cursed: “You’re not at the fourth layer of Qi Refining! You’re… at the tenth?!”
Damn it, she had hidden this deep.
These sect disciples were too crafty.
Still cloaked in shadow, the man saw Rong Shu continuing to attack in his direction and stayed calm.
According to the information he had gathered, Rong Shu possessed only Wind-Fire Dual Spiritual Roots.
The sect had tested her roots; a cultivator could hide their realm, but spirit roots did not lie.
He only needed to wait for Rong Shu to waste her spiritual energy. Then killing a stink-of-milk little girl would be easy.
Even if he alone could not finish her, there were a dozen demonic cultivators in the grove.
While he was indulging in this rosy thought, he went cold as Rong Shu’s entire figure melted into shadow as well.
She arrowed through the darkness toward him.
At some point the single blade in her hand had become two, and a thin, pale-golden sheen had filmed both blades.
Two arcs whipped out together.
They cut down toward the man.
“This… this is impossible!”
Panicked, the man tried to block.
But Rong Shu’s cultivation outstripped his by a layer. Once he lost the advantage of diving into shadows at will, he became a lamb on the block.
Her Twin Blades pierced his abdomen, driving clean through.
White blade in, red blade out.
Rong Shu twisted her wrists. Both knives churned inside him, then scissored to either side, cutting his body cleanly in half.
“…Aaaaah!”
His scream lasted only a few seconds before Rong Shu drove a blade through his skull and nailed him dead in the shadow itself.
When his aura finally faded, the two halves of his corpse floated up from the ground.
His wide eyes were fixed with disbelief and terror.
After she finished the man, Rong Shu did not linger. She moved at once.
Elsewhere, the sudden emergence of a formation had forced a truce among the demonic cultivators mid-brawl.
From the original fifteen, five already lay dead in the melee. The rest all carried wounds of one sort or another.
Just as they began to search for a way to break the array, the formation shifted.
Mist boiled up around them. Before anyone could react, the fog unraveled the group and scattered them.
Within the fog, a black silhouette slowly took shape.
The shadow figure, two horizontal sabers in hand, slipped through the mist again and again.
With every step, a scream split the haze. Hot blood spattered the ground with ticking sounds.
Rong Shu killed until only Liu Kai remained.
Facing the man whose heart had already died even as his body still fought back, Rong Shu leaned on the solid pressure of her tenth-layer Qi Refining cultivation and ground him down.
“Brother, safe travels,” she said, patting Liu Kai on the shoulder. Before he could react, her other hand flashed; one clean stroke sent his head tumbling.
After killing all of the demonic cultivators, Rong Shu dispelled the array’s fog and began to search the bodies.
She went through the dozen or so corpses one by one and collected several dozen Storage Pouches.
The possessions of demonic cultivators were not especially rare or precious, but there were many of them, and quantity makes a pile.
By Rong Shu’s estimate, once converted to Spirit Stones, the haul would fully cover the cost of using the array this time.
The formation was consumable; each use diminished it.
Even after subtracting expenses, Rong Shu had still turned a tidy profit.
More importantly, she had removed a portion of her hidden dangers.
After tidying the scene, she checked twice more. Once certain she had left nothing behind, she took the Little Hamster and departed.
A dozen demonic cultivators disappearing at once might draw the attention of their sects.
So in the days to come, Rong Shu decided not to go to the Alchemist Sub-Guild at all and to hide in Dragon Ridge Palace instead.
True, Dragon Ridge Palace was a big target. There were many sect disciples here, and the demonic cultivator sects would likely focus on it first.
But hiding outside without the sect’s protection carried far more risk and uncertainty.
Who could say whether the demonic cultivators might suddenly decide to slaughter the city?
When Rong Shu stepped onto Dragon Ridge Palace grounds, she finally let out a long breath.
With the liability of Liu Kai gone, her “Xu Liu” demonic cultivator persona should hold a while longer.
She was in good spirits when, a short distance on, she ran into people she would rather avoid.
A girl’s voice was trembling with tears as she said: “Senior Brother, it was so frightening. I almost couldn’t see you… sob…”
A male voice soothed her: “Ruan Ruan, don’t be afraid. They’re all dead. No one will hurt you.”
The girl hiccupped: “Good thing you were here, otherwise…”
Her words trailed off and she began to cry again.
Then Feng Lin and Qin Yuan added their reassurances one after another.
Hearing this exchange, Rong Shu raised her brows.
So Yu Ruan Ruan had been ambushed by demonic cultivators.
Judging from the situation, Feng Lin and Qin Yuan had saved her.
Yu Ruan Ruan was at the Foundation Establishment Stage. The demonic cultivators who had attacked her were likely at Foundation Establishment, if not at the Golden Core Stage.
With that in mind, Rong Shu turned to leave.
She could not linger near Yu Ruan Ruan.
If the demonic cultivators tailing Yu Ruan Ruan at Foundation Establishment or Golden Core also fixed on her, it would be a headache.
But as Rong Shu moved to go, Yu Ruan Ruan spotted her.
The girl called out: “Junior Sister, you’re here too.”
Qin Yuan turned and said: “Junior Sister Rong?”
Caught out, Rong Shu could not slip away unnoticed. She turned and greeted them politely: “Senior Brothers, Senior Sister.”
Qin Yuan, taking in Rong Shu for the first time in days, frowned as he said: “Did you just come back from outside? Be careful these next few days. Stop running around for fun.”
Rong Shu nodded: “All right, Senior Brother Qin.”
Yu Ruan Ruan pressed a hand to her chest and looked at Rong Shu with anxious concern as she said: “Yes, Junior Sister, there have been more and more incidents of demonic cultivators attacking sect disciples in the city. You mustn’t wander about. There’s always time to play, but if you run into demonic cultivators, you could lose your life.”
Rong Shu was about to nod when Feng Lin snorted and said: “Ruan Ruan, don’t bother with her.”
He added, “If she insists on running out to court death, no one else is to blame.”
His eyes were cold as he thought that the best outcome would be for her to die at demonic cultivators’ hands and be done with it.
Rong Shu kept her face courteous as she said: “Thank you for your concern, Senior Brothers, Senior Sister. I won’t step beyond Dragon Ridge Palace in the coming days.”
Yu Ruan Ruan said: “Junior Sister, come to think of it, I don’t even know where you live.”
She continued with a touch of grievance in her eyes: “It’s been so many days and you haven’t come to see us. What have you been doing?”
Rong Shu was still thinking about how to gloss that over when Yu Ruan Ruan chattered on: “The sect grand competition has been wonderful. Did you watch it, Junior Sister? Our senior brothers are amazing. They should have no trouble making the top twenty. I’ve been the one holding us back… I’ll be lucky to squeeze into the top fifty.”
With that, Yu Ruan Ruan looked ashamed.
Rong Shu nodded and said sincerely: “Senior Brothers and Senior Sister are formidable. I’ll learn from your example.”
Suddenly, Yu Ruan Ruan’s glance flicked sideways and lit on the Little Hamster: “Junior Sister, what is that in your hands…”
The Little Hamster was so small that Rong Shu could cup it completely with both hands.
But since Rong Shu had been holding her hands in the same position for so long, Yu Ruan Ruan’s attention had naturally been drawn to them.
On a closer look, she noticed something was off.
Since she had been discovered, Rong Shu no longer hid it and said: “Just a little pet I came across recently.”
When Yu Ruan Ruan saw it was only an ordinary Little Hamster, a flicker of disdain crossed her eyes, though her mouth formed the words: “So cute. Junior Sister, could you let me hold it?”
Inwardly, malice rippled through her as she thought: [If I take that Little Hamster and “accidentally” drop it… that small one would surely die from the fall. Then Rong Shu would be heartbroken, wouldn’t she.]
